Can anyone give me ANY numbers on acceleration times for highway speeds on a 2k2 auto? I was bored and reading thru the MAF threads and a lot of people are saying they replaced the MAF and thought their car was fine..but runs better now. I drive mostly highway and always thought the car was slow on the highway but im not sure. can anybody post times such as 50-70 mph 60-80 mph etc etc id greatly appreciate it. ill try to get times for myself.

ok well i tried a few runs today im getting:
3rd gear only: 70-80 3.9 seconds 80-90: 4.0 sec
2nd to 3rd gear fully automatic: 60-80 APPROX 7.5-8 sec

do those numbers sound right for an auto? Im just worried that my MAF is starting to go bad...i started losing highway power in my other max before my MAF went bad..but didnt know all this back than.
